Allen and Briony, self-described rabbit show and rabbit history geeks, have long been contemplating a way to capture and share stories, lessons and inspiration with fellow hobbyists and the world at large. As Covid-19 shut down shows, fairs and much of this community’s ability to get together, they realized that a podcast could help. This podcast covers a variety of relevant topics for anyone interested in the rabbit and cavy hobby. From a new exhibitor to someone with decades of experience, there is something for everyone to gain from listening to the guests and hosts each episode.
